  • Title

    Explore of the Electricity Information Acquisition System´s Clock Synchronization Method

  • Abstract
    According to such problems as acquisition terminal and smart meter´s real-time deviation is large which has lead to TOU power price and ladder power price policy difficult to successfully implement in electricity information acquisition system, this paper has applied GPS clock synchronization technology and PTP clock synchronization technology in electricity information acquisition system´s simulation platform. It has proposed a microsecond accuracy clock synchronization methods to ensure acquisition terminal and smart meter´s clock is accurate, reliable and unity based on master station, acquisition terminals and smart meter´s three-tiered clock synchronization mechanism.
